解决内核更新到4.15.0-91-generic后与nvidia-418.87.01驱动不匹配问题
众所周知,在Ubuntu上安装CUDA的体验非常之差。(惭愧的是本人没有从零开始装CUDA的体验,但是经常找不到NVIDIA驱动的体验已经够差了。)
之前组里的服务器很少出现这个问题,自从开始用系里的服务器后,NVIDIA在我这的印象 ≈ \approx ≈ 弱不禁风、不堪一击、楚楚不可连(名叫楚楚的显卡经常连不上)…
在时不时地影响到实验进度+常用的解决方法突然失效导致前两天只能先把代码搬回组服跑之后,终于决定重装驱动并且整理一下之前搜到过的所有解决方案,以备不时之需(淦)。
环境说明
Ubuntu sever18.04
原内核版本4.15.0-88
更新后内核版本4.15.0-91
NVIDIA驱动版本418.87.01
问题
跑实验的时候突然显示没有对应的显卡。
执行nvidia-smi命令后显示:
NVIDIA-SMI has failed because it couldn't communicate with the NVIDIA driver. Make sure that the latest NVIDIA driver is installed and running.
网上说主要原因是因为Ubuntu内核更新了,使用以下命令查看内核信息&